MSM Narrative Fail: Majority Of Seniors Have A Favorable View Of Paul Ryan
Image
"... That young man...what's his name? Paul Ryan?... He's such a nice boy..."
Quote:
An ABC News/Washington Post poll released early Wednesday found that 50 percent of senior citizens 65 years and older have a favorable view of Ryan, the GOP vice presidential pick, while 35 percent hold an unfavorable view. Fifteen percent, the poll found, don’t have an opinion.

Democrats had expected Ryan to be especially unpopular with older Americans because of his budget proposal which shifts Medicare into a subsidized private insurance model system for those currently under the age of 55. President Obama’s campaign has hit Ryan hard for his Medicare plans, saying that they would raise healthcare costs for seniors.

But Ryan, since presumptive GOP nominee Mitt Romney tapped him for the ticket, has not shied away from his budget plan. He has countered with attacks on Obama, claiming he weakened Medicare by cutting funds to pay for his healthcare reform bill.

The poll also found that 41 percent of seniors over 65 have a favorable view of Vice President Joe Biden while 52 percent have an unfavorable view and 7 percent have no opinion.

Paul Ryan’s Most Egregious Lie: He Never Ran a Marathon in Under Three Hours
Quote:
Republican vice presidential candidate and fitness enthusiast Paul Ryan has been caught in a lie that could destroy his political career.

Quote:
Paul Ryan has never run a marathon in under three hours.
Last week, Ryan claimed his personal best was "two hour and fifty-something." But that doesn't match up with the facts.

Quote:
Runner's World checked 11 years of results for Grandma's Marathon, from 1988 through 1998, and found a finisher in the 1990 race by the name of Paul D. Ryan, 20, of Minneapolis.

Ryan's middle name is Davis, and he was 20 in 1990. The finishing time listed was 4 hours, 1 minute and 25 seconds.
